Bevan Docherty: I have done my job
(Beijing,September 16 ) The men's final of the "Good Luck Beijing" BG Triathlon World Cup ended at the Changping Triathlon Venue at the Ming Tombs Reservoir on September 16. World No.4 Bevan Docherty of New Zealand won the bronze medal with a total result of one hour 49 minutes 8 seconds. After the competition he gave an interview to the media.
Bevan Docherty felt satisfied with today's reslut. Commenting on his performance he said: "In run I kept tight with the leading athletes and felt very relaxed in the first two laps. But it was a pity that I was still a liitle bit slower than the winner. "
New Zealand took the tournament as one of the Olympics qualifications and sent fourˇˇtriathletes. For the four participants, this was also a selection for the upcoming Olympics among them so everyone wished to have good mark.
